The scrollTop property sets or returns the number of pixels an element's content is scrolled vertically. Tip: Use the scrollLeft property to set or return the number of pixels an element's content is scrolled horizontally. Tip: To add scrollbars to an element, use the CSS overflow property.

window scroll to top angularjs

Tip: The onscroll event occurs when an element's scrollbar is being scrolled. Toggle between class names on different scroll positions - When the user scrolls down 50 pixels from the top of the page, the class name "test" will be added to an element and removed when scrolled up again. Slide in an element when the user has scrolled down pixels from the top of the page add the slideUp class :.

If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ail:. Therefore, we use the documentElement property for these browsers body. Example Toggle between class names on different scroll positions - When the user scrolls down 50 pixels from the top of the page, the class name "test" will be added to an element and removed when scrolled up again. Example Slide in an element when the user has scrolled down pixels from the top of the page add the slideUp class : window.

Remove this line to show the triangle before scroll draw triangle. HOW TO. Your message has been sent to W3Schools. W3Schools is optimized for learning, testing, and training. Examples might be simplified to improve reading and basic understanding.

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. While using this site, you agree to have read and accepted our terms of usecookie and privacy policy. Copyright by Refsnes Data. All Rights Reserved.

Powered by W3.

Get and set scroll position of an element

Specifies the number of pixels the element's content is scrolled vertically. Special notes: If the number is a negative value, the number is set to "0" If the element cannot be scrolled, the number is set to "0" If the number is greater than the maximum allowed scroll amount, the number is set to the maximum number. A Number, representing the number of pixels that the element's content has been scrolled vertically.I struggled with this problem some time ago.

I did not want to load the jQuery library for this reason. Your easeInOutQuad function solved my problem. My class you can find here. Thanks for you. Made a small lib for smooth scroll animations. Awesome and simple solution! Here's the code a bit modernized. Now it's a lot smoother and works in Safari as well. If you don't work with babel then replace const with var. Thank you very, very much. Much helpful. One tip though, I'd suggest updating to ES6 standards, you know like replcaing var with let or const and arrow functions etc.

Bonus Bonus Points: a rename the function so it doesnt actually override "scrollto" for the window b add a flag that prevents "upwards" scrolling, yes that may only be my usecase but YMMV. Thank you very much! It's unfortunately not usable for any element on the page. Very useful!! Skip to content. Instantly share code, notes, and snippets.

Code Revisions 1 Stars Forks Embed What would you like to do? Embed Embed this gist in your website. Share Copy sharable link for this gist.The Window. For relative scrolling, see Window. For scrolling elements, see Element. Get the latest and greatest from MDN delivered straight to your inbox. Sign in to enjoy the benefits of an MDN account. The compatibility table in this page is generated from structured data. Last modified: Mar 23,by MDN contributors.

Related Topics. If the name doesn't exist, then a new browsing context is opened in a new tab or a new window, and the specified resource is loaded into it. Learn the best of web development Get the latest and greatest from MDN delivered straight to your inbox. The newsletter is offered in English only at the moment.

Sign up now. Sign in with Github Sign in with Google. Chrome Full support 1. Edge Full support Firefox Full support 1. IE Full support 4.

AngularJS Tutorials for beginners #11. AngularJS AnchorScroll to scroll a web page

Opera Full support 3. Safari Full support 1. WebView Android Full support 1. Chrome Android Full support Firefox Android Full support 4. Opera Android Full support Safari iOS Full support 1. Samsung Internet Android Full support 1. Chrome Full support Firefox Full support Yes.

IE No support No. Opera Full support Safari No support No. WebView Android Full support Help to translate the content of this tutorial to your language! How do we find the width and height of the browser window? How do we get the full width and height of the document, including the scrolled out part?

How do we scroll the page using JavaScript? For most such requests, we can use the root document element document. But there are additional methods and peculiarities important enough to consider. Browsers also support properties window.

How TO - Scroll Back To Top Button

They look like what we want. So why not to use them instead? In most cases we need the available window width: to draw or position something.

That is: inside scrollbars if there are any. So we should use documentElement. Odd things are possible. Theoretically, as the root document element is document. But on that element, for the whole page, these properties do not work as intended. Sounds like a nonsense, weird, right? For document scroll document. We can do the same for the page using document. The method scrollBy x,y scrolls the page relative to its current position.

window scroll to top angularjs

For instance, scrollBy 0,10 scrolls the page 10px down. The call to elem. It has one argument:. For instance, when we need to cover it with a large message requiring immediate attention, and we want the visitor to interact with that message, not with the document.

The page will freeze on its current scroll. The drawback of the method is that the scrollbar disappears. That looks a bit odd, but can be worked around if we compare clientWidth before and after the freeze, and if it increased the scrollbar disappeared then add padding to document.By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service.

The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. I want to scroll to the top of the page after getting an ajax call response using angularjs. Basically, I am displaying alert messages on top of the page and I want to focus the alert message as the ajax response received.

Ideally we should do it from either controller or directive as per applicable. For more information please see this documentation. Learn more. How to scroll to top of the page in AngularJS? Ask Question. Asked 5 years, 1 month ago. Active 2 years, 1 month ago. Viewed k times. Farjad Hasan Farjad Hasan 3, 6 6 gold badges 19 19 silver badges 34 34 bronze badges.

Window sizes and scrolling

Active Oldest Votes. Alexander T. MuhammadReda when you say put here your element' is that the id of the element? MuhammadReda I have it working now thanks. Instead of angular. I don't know why but these both codes are not working. I'm using it with ng-calendar directive. Muhammad Reda Muhammad Reda Partha Sarathi Ghosh Partha Sarathi Ghosh 7, 14 14 gold badges 46 46 silver badges 79 79 bronze badges. Don't forget you can also use pure JavaScript to deal with this situation, using: window.

Ignacio Ara Ignacio Ara 1, 2 2 gold badges 17 17 silver badges 29 29 bronze badges.The scrollTop method sets or returns the vertical scrollbar position for the selected elements. When used to return the position: This method returns the vertical position of the scrollbar for the FIRST matched element.

window scroll to top angularjs

When used to set the position: This method sets the vertical position of the scrollbar for ALL matched elements. Set the vertical scrollbar position How to set the vertical scrollbar position for an element.

Toggle between classes on different scroll positions How to toggle between classes on different scroll positions. Add smooth scrolling to page anchors Using animate together with scrollTop to add smooth scrolling to links.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ail:. HOW TO. Your message has been sent to W3Schools. W3Schools is optimized for learning, testing, and training. Examples might be simplified to improve reading and basic understanding.

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. While using this site, you agree to have read and accepted our terms of usecookie and privacy policy.

Copyright by Refsnes Data. All Rights Reserved. Powered by W3.Method 1: Using window. It accepts 2 parameters the x and y coordinate of the page to scroll to. Passing both the parameters as 0 will scroll the page to the topmost and leftmost point. In jQuery, the scrollTo method is used to set or return the vertical scrollbar position for a selected element.

This behavior can be used to scroll to the top of the page by applying this method on the window property. Setting the position parameter to 0 scrolls the page to the top. If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.

See your article appearing on the GeeksforGeeks main page and help other Geeks.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below. Writing code in comment? Please use ide. How to pass an array as a function parameter in JavaScript? When and why to 'return false' in JavaScript? How to change the value of a global variable inside of a function using JavaScript?

How to move mouse pointer to a specific position using JavaScript? File uploading in React. How to get client IP address using JavaScript? How to clone array in ES6? How to get the coordinates of a mouse click on a canvas element? A scrollable page can be scrolled to the top using 2 approaches: Method 1: Using window.

window scroll to top angularjs

Scroll to the top of the. This is a. Click to scroll to top. Scroll to the top of the page. Click on the button below to. GeeksforGeeks is a computer. This is a large scrollable area.

Hide scroll bar, but while still being able to scroll using CSS How to display search result of another page on same page using ajax in JSP?


Written by

thoughts on “Window scroll to top angularjs

Leave a Reply

Your email address will not be published. Required fields are marked *